Yes, there can be different cost factors for male-to-female (MTF) and female-to-male (FTM) surgeries due to the differences in the procedures involved and the surgical techniques used. Here are some factors that may contribute to cost differences between MTF and FTM surgeries:
- Type of Surgery: The specific gender-affirming procedures vary between MTF and FTM surgeries. MTF surgeries typically include breast augmentation (implants), tracheal shave, facial feminization surgery (FFS), and genital surgery (vaginoplasty). FTM surgeries include top surgery (chest reconstruction), hysterectomy, metoidioplasty, and phalloplasty.
- Complexity and Time: The complexity and duration of the surgeries can differ. MTF genital surgeries, such as vaginoplasty, are often more complex and time-consuming than FTM genital surgeries like metoidioplasty. The complexity of FFS can also contribute to the cost differences.
- Surgeon’s Experience: The level of experience and expertise of the surgeon can influence the cost. Surgeons with more experience and reputation in performing gender-affirming surgeries may have higher fees.
- Geographic Location: The cost of living and medical expenses can vary by geographic location. Procedures performed in larger cities or regions with higher living costs may be more expensive.
- Facility and Anesthesia Fees: The choice of surgical facility and the type of anesthesia used can impact the overall cost.
- Insurance Coverage: The extent of insurance coverage for gender-affirming surgeries can differ between MTF and FTM procedures. Some insurance plans may cover certain procedures but not others, leading to variations in out-of-pocket costs.
- Presurgical Requirements: Some surgeries may have specific presurgical requirements, such as hormone therapy or psychological evaluations, which can add to the overall cost.
